Austria is home to significant global organizations like the Organisation for Security and Cooperation in Europe (OSCE) and the International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A). The country is positioning itself as a key player in international diplomacy and a center for resolving conflicts. Foreign Minister Beate Meinl-Reisinger emphasizes the importance of maintaining Austria’s longstanding military neutrality despite ongoing conflicts like the war in Ukraine. The nation’s commitment to neutrality is seen as a foundation for its diplomatic efforts.
